Output 5207629fb3fc904bdeec315075a85884eec3a2f2a42863ee4dada7c099a9156a:12

value
107334
script pubkey
OP_0 OP_PUSHBYTES_20 bf2a93e656cbedb661c2cce7536d35e48bd1a703
address
bc1qhu4f8ejke0kmvcwzenn4xmf4uj9arfcreqx3xr
transaction
5207629fb3fc904bdeec315075a85884eec3a2f2a42863ee4dada7c099a9156a
spent
true